The legislature of Geisenroda is the unicameral Volkskammer. The legislature has 450 seats with elections being conducted based with a closed list party-list proportional system, seats are allocated to parties based on their percentage of their vote, and parties distribute seats to members in any way they see fit. The Volkskammer is responsible for proposing and voting on laws with any approved by a majority going to the chancellor, alongside the power to approve constitutional changes with a two-thirds majority vote. Despite once having the power to remove former chancellor's immunity from prosecution and impeach chancellors, these powers were stripped from the Volkskammer in a 2002 constitutional amendment.  


Geisenroda's constitution gives universal suffrage to all citizens to vote in elections which take place every 8 years.
